Make Sleep a Priority

This may not be at the top of your list, and that is precisely the problem. Running around ragged and working yourself to the bone is not good for you! Starting and continuing the new year with a better sleep pattern can clear up a lot of stress.

There is a reason why doctors ask patients how many hours of sleep they get at night. Prioritize sleep and rest, and watch how so many other areas in your life improve. Your health will improve, your stress will decrease, and you’ll be more clear-headed when making difficult decisions.

Organized the Disorganized

Nobody is perfect, and if anyone says they are, they’re lying. Everyone has areas of improvement in their lives. Instead of tackling them all at once, do one thing at a time. Is it work? Is it personal? Whichever it is, try and get to the root of the problem.


It might be as simple as cleaning and organizing your workspace. Maybe you don’t have a home office, and that’s the cause of it all. Working at the kitchen table may be counterproductive, and you need to find a space where you can remain focused.

Say Goodbye

Out with the old and in with the new. Even if you don’t know what the new is just yet, you should make some room for it. Remove everything from your life that does not serve you anymore—and that goes for the non-tangible items too.

Adjust the Timeline

If you take away nothing else from this post, leave with this last tip: Adjust the timeline. There is no required end date for improving and changing. Too many people say they want to accomplish something by a specific date, and if they don’t, they feel like failures.

Don’t limit yourself to a specific time for certain goals. As people, we are changing and growing every day. What you don’t accomplish in 2023, you can always do in the following year. Just remember to be graceful with yourself and every goal you set.
